Lots of customers compare PSA Oxygen Generator and VPSA Oxygen Generator innovations due to the fact that both prevail in industrial oxygen applications. VPSA stands for Vacuum Pressure Swing Adsorption, and it is typically used for larger flow rates and particular industrial oxygen demands. The difference between PSA and VPSA Oxygen Generator systems exists mostly in process pressure, vacuum regeneration, efficiency at scale, and typical application range. PSA Oxygen Generator systems are normally extra portable and are usually picked for smaller to medium oxygen production needs, including Medical Oxygen Plant and smaller sized Industrial Oxygen Generator arrangements. VPSA Oxygen Equipment Manufacturer solutions are usually associated with larger quantity oxygen production, such as Industrial VPSA Oxygen Generator or VPSA Oxygen Production Plant installments. In technique, the inquiry of which is better PSA or VPSA Oxygen Generator relies on the circulation demand, oxygen purity target, power expense, available room, and customer tons profile. For some centers, PSA provides the best balance of simpleness and price. For others, VPSA can provide better business economics at greater capabilities.

A complete gas generation system does not begin with the generator itself. Compressed air should be clean, dry, and appropriately conditioned to shield the molecular filters and guarantee steady oxygen or nitrogen pureness. Without correct air purification, also the best PSA Oxygen Generator Manufacturer or Industrial Nitrogen Generator Manufacturer system can endure from lowered efficiency, greater upkeep, and shorter solution life.

The broader market for industrial gas production consists of even more than oxygen and nitrogen. An Oxygen Nitrogen Argon Plant, Oxygen Nitrogen Plant Manufacturer, or Industrial Gas Plant Manufacturer may supply adsorption-based or cryogenic systems depending on the required capacities and items. In massive applications, an Air Separation Plant, Air Separation Unit - ASU, or Cryogenic Air Separation Unit is commonly used to generate oxygen, nitrogen, and argon from atmospheric air. These systems use cryogenic purification instead of adsorption and are typically suitable for high-volume industrial gas supply.
